The engine that powers a crane burns fuel at a flame temperature of 2000°C. It is cooled by 20°C air. The crane lifts a 2000 kg steel girder 30 m upward. How much heat energy is transferred to the engine by burning fuel if the engine is 40% as efficient as a Carnot engine?
